Mini Facelifts are Very Popular

By: Aazdak Alissimmo No matter where in the world you are, from Miami to New York, Los Angeles or even in Paris, you may have noticed a trend of people wanting to look younger. Facelifts are one of the best ways to achieve this goal, and they are also some of the most popular ways to look younger.

Of course, there are plenty of other options to try before getting your face operated on. There are creams and other external treatments that can really make a difference in the way that your skin looks and feels. Laser resurfacing can also help your skin to have a youthful glow and shine.

Other alternatives to facelifts include the ever popular Botox injections for wrinkles that are around the brow line, and dermal fillers such as Restylane for wrinkles found in the mouth area. These can help with minor wrinkles, and delay the need for a facelift for a few years.

Sometimes, however, other treatments don't work and you just have to go for the big guns. In these cases, the surgical step known as a facelift may be your only option. For many years, patients had just one choice in facelifts - the full facelift, a lengthy procedure with a lengthy cut.

Today, even the full facelift usually does not require such a drastic amount of cutting. Small incisions can usually be made in the hairline in order to pull skin and tissue to a tight appearance, cutting any excess tissue and skin away leaving the face looking younger and less wrinkled.

Full facelifts are no longer the only options for people wanting to get a facelift - if you do not have wrinkles or issues covering your entire face, you may want to try the mini facelift. The mini facelift can be used when a patient has wrinkles on just half of their face, the lower half, and/or saggy jowls.

Less surgery means that you may not even need general anesthesia for this procedure - depending on your doctor's preference. You may be able to have local anesthetic shots along with a sedative in order to have the mini facelift performed in the plastic surgeon's office.

Incisions for the mini facelift are different - they are smaller, and usually found only around the ear. The procedure is much the same, however, with tissues being pulled up and occasionally removed, then sutured to give a smoother and more tight appearance to the skin of the face.

While the mini facelift is not for everyone, it is a good option for those people who need to have work done in the lower areas of their face, but don't want to have to have an entire facelift surgery. This surgery works well for many people, but be sure to discuss the risks and results with your doctor.
